Fast Load abend - IEC146I 513-04

You are running Platinum Fast Load job and the job fails on you with an "IEC146I 513-04" error.

IEC146I 513-04 means
"An OPEN macro instruction was issued for a magnetic tape data set allocated to a device that already has an open data set on it. Make sure that the first data set is closed before the second is opened, or allocate the second data set to a different device. This error may be due to a
previous abnormal end associated with the same unit in the same step. If so, correct the error causing the previous abnormal end."

Problem:
As per the above message, you are trying open the dataset for two different purposes in the same job step.

In your LOAD card, see what you've specified for INDDN. In my case, I had specified INDDN SYSREC.

Fast Load user guide says "If you will be performing an OUTPUT-CONTROL ALL type load, and you want to specify INDDN SYSREC, you must also specify UNLDDN and change its default value. Otherwise, Unicenter Fast Load will try to use SYSREC as an input and a work file."

OUTPUT-CONTROL ALL is the default. I noticed that I didn't have a UNLDDN DD name in my JCL.

Fix:
Either specify a UNLDDN DD in your JCL step or change INDDN to something other than SYSREC. I changed it to SYSULD and it worked.

CA Intertest (Batch) Tips

If you use CA's Intertest for Batch to debug your batch COBOL programs or stored procedures, read on.

There are a few commands that you use frequently. Set them commands in PFKEYS for ease of use:

STEP 1 - Set steps to go in each run to 1 (I usually set it to PF4)
GO - Run as many steps as described in the STEP command (I usually set it to PF5)
RUN - Run until the next breakpoint (I usually set it to PF6)
KUP - Scroll Up in the Data Display Window (I usually set it to PF17)
KDOWN - Scroll Down in the Data Display Window (I usually set it to PF18)

Platinum Fast Load Error "PFL8013E"

If a Fast Load job fails with PFL8013E (Error Description: A table within Table Space that has multiple versioned rows is not supported for this release of Unicenter Fastload. Reason: This DB2 V8 feature is not yet supported by Unicenter Fast Load. Processing terminates), it could be because the tablespace is in AREO (Advisory Reorg pending) status. This happens in a DB2 V8 NFM subsystem, with Fast Load (version r11.5) Resume NO REPLACE option specified.

How will you fix this? There are a few options that you can try:

1. Run REORG utility on the tablespace and retry loading.

2. If that doesn't work, drop and recreate the table and then load the table using Fast Load

3. If that doesn't work, try IBM LOAD. That should definitely work.
